Korean Air completes Asiana acquisition
Seoul-based Korean Air has completed the acquisition of rival Asiana Airlines, four years after first announcing the move. On December 12, 2024, the flag carrier acquired 131,578,947 newly issued shares in Asiana, representing a 63.88% ownership stake and making Asiana a subsidiary of Korean Air. The completion follows Korean Air’s payment of £450m to Asiana Airlines on December 11, concluding the share purchase transaction. This brings the total investment to £847.4m.
